This is awesome so far! A few ideas I have: 1. For the display, you can add a small pirate ship build on the water (or a shipwreck) along with some skulls and bones imagery to decorate the pirates’ side. (You may want to extend the display a bit for more room.) 2. On the royal side, you can add some simple castle ramparts to give the idea of the pirates storming the king’s castle. Maybe with more flags, banners, etc. and scatter a few more palm trees along the shore. 3. For the royal bishop, you could build a small miniature medieval church diorama or a simpler wooden throne with a decorate stained glass window backdrop. 4. For the pirate pieces, you can lean into the skull imagery and design thrones with skulls, cutlasses, or pistols built in. A pirate bishop piece could be the ship’s navigator with a map in front of him, the pirate knight could be a gunner atop a cannon, and the pirate rook can be a pirate in the crow’s nest of a ship mast, maybe with a sail.
